Bluebird Lineup: Stephen Stills - lead guitar, vocals Neil Young - lead guitar, vocals Richie Furay - rhythm guitar, vocals Jim Messina - bass Dewey Martin - drums, vocals Extracts from original notes: Opening for the Springfield were classmates Bob Wahler, and the band he played in, Hard Candy. Bill Wardner played in Hard Candy (along with Bill Brumback, Mike Peters, and Rick Huhnke), and had the presence of mind to lug his Sony TC-200 stereo tape recorder to the gig.
